Suffering From Headache, Sore Eyes, Hot And Cold Flashes. What Is The Cure?

Question: I went to bed the other night with a headache. Once in bed I began to get very hot. The headache got worse and I had very little sleep. The following day the headache still remain, sore eyes, hot and cold flashes. My ears feel like they are block too and very little strength. It's now day 2 and I still feel the same. I'm not overly hungry. I did have a bout of bronchitis last week which had seemed have cleared up & I was on a 2 week course of antibiotic
Brief Answer:
Can be related to infection.
Detailed Answer:
Hello,
Thanks for trusting us with your health concern.
The persistent headache for two days with hot and cold flashes could be due to a generalized viral infection, headache due to tension, stress, decreased fluid intake and electrolyte imbalance, post infection weakness, etc.
You can also take tablet Tylenol 600mg thrice a day for 4 days. Avoid temperature extremes. Drink plenty of fluids and consume plenty of fruits and vegetables.
If the symptoms do not improve or you have worsening of headache, review with your doctor for careful examination and to obtain more specific prescription medication.
